Brandon M. Rosenbluth joined PFM in 2010 and is currently located in the Philadelphia office. He is a member of the Synario team, which provides financial modeling software and service.  He leads the Client Service team, which is responsible for the overall success of all Synario users. The team supports the full life cycle of client interactions with the platform, from training and configuring models during implementation to the on-going support needs of all Synario users. Lastly, the team is responsible for developing additional programs and resources for users to take advantage of as their use of the platform evolves.

Brandon also serves as Product Owner, responsible for prioritizing changes to the software and ensuring it continues to meet the needs of our users.  Finally, Brandon also serves as a member of the Management Team at Synario.

Prior to this role, Brandon led Synario's Higher Education practice, focusing on Enterprise implementations and ensuring users were successful on the platform. Additionally, he led the development team which designed and built the Synopsis for Higher Education product. He also has experience in PFM’s Strategic Forecasting Group, helping clients analyze the financial ramifications of various operating and capital initiatives, and helps communicate those results to key stakeholders at the organization.
